2007: Started 36 games for the Bulls and played in 44... Went 2-for-2 at the plate with a run batted in against Le Moyne (3/29)... Was 6-for-10 with five runs scored in a three-game series against Ohio. 2006: Appeared in 21 games getting the starting nod in the final 12 games of the season... Had a season-high two runs batted in against Bowling Green... Had back-to-back 2-for-4 performances in the series against the Falcons... Finished the season batting .327 (16-49)... Had a season-high seven putouts against Niagara. 2005: Appeared in eight games in spot duty as a reserve catcher and as a pinch-hitter... Had hits in four of last five at-bats of season, including RBI singles against Towson (3/18) and Central Michigan (5/15)... Also scored runs in games against Kent State (5/1) and Toledo (5/6)... Spent most of the season recovering from shoulder surgery... A UB Scholar Athlete in both semesters. 2004: Redshirted during first year at UB...A UB Scholar Athlete. High School: A three-year letterwinner for head coach Brian Tenney at Canisius High School...Hit .417 with 11 doubles, three triples and 21 RBIs his senior season... Named All-Catholic as a junior and a senior...Named second-team All-Western New York as a senior...Earned his team’s Mr. Defense Award as a junior and a senior...Named MVP of his American Legion team in 2003. Personal: Full name is Richard Joseph Oliveri... Born November 1, 1984... Majoring in accounting... Parents are Richard and Paula Oliveri... Father played professional baseball... Has a sister, Cassondra, who is a swimmer at UB... Favorite movie is The Natural... Favorite athlete is Derek Jeter... Father was a professional baseball player and appeared in The Natural.
